Ticket: config drift between prod and staging for the Relaybox queue migration. We're replacing the homegrown Stackrun queue with Relaybox, but staging picked up retry settings that never landed in prod, so failover tests pass only in staging. Future maintainers: treat staging as authoritative until the cutover completes. The values staging currently runs, which prod must be aligned to, are these.

deployment values, faduf-tawep:
SORDOR_LOG_LEVEL=error
SORDOR_METRICS_HOST=metrics.sordor.nelvrolabs.internal
SORDOR_POOL_SIZE=4

**14:22 — Read-replica lag alarm (Dovetail cluster)**

Heads up, support folks: the lag alarm on the Dovetail read replica fired at 14:22 and cleared by 14:51. During that window, customers may have seen stale order statuses in the Cartline dashboard — up to eight minutes behind. No writes were lost, and nothing needs manual repair on your end. If anyone reports missing orders from that window, ask them to refresh before escalating. For reference, the replica snapshot in question carries the token below.

pipeline stamp: htk31_f769b577b3028a4e9958e5bb8d1259a

## Service Accounts — Pagefold GraphQL N+1 Fix

This page covers the service account used while validating the Pagefold N+1 query fix. The resolver batching layer (DataTrawl) now coalesces author lookups, cutting per-request database calls from ~400 to 3. As a contractor, you'll verify this against the staging gateway using the `svc-pagefold-bench` account, which has query-only scope and a 30-day expiry. Logs land in the Harrowgate dashboard under the benchmarking namespace. Authenticate your benchmark runs with the key below.

API key for yahig-tadup: kto7_ubizbYm